Skip to content

gzeinnumer/ViewPagerNonSwipableWithDotsButDisableClick

Repository files navigation

ViewPagerNonSwipableWithDotsButDisableClick

view pager dengan dots, tapi dots tidak bsa di tekan

public class MainActivity extends AppCompatActivity {

    ...
    
    public static TabLayout dotsTabStatic;
    
    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_main);

        dotsTab = findViewById(R.id.dots_tab);
        dotsTabStatic = dotsTab;

        ...
        
        LinearLayout tabStrip = ((LinearLayout) dotsTab.getChildAt(0));
        for (int i = 0; i < tabStrip.getChildCount(); i++) {
            tabStrip.getChildAt(i).setOnTouchListener(new View.OnTouchListener() {
                @Override
                public boolean onTouch(View v, MotionEvent event) {
                    return true;
                }
            });
        }
    }
}

Copyright 2020 M. Fadli Zein

About

view pager dengan dots, tapi dots tidak bsa di tekan

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ages